The Climats celebrate their world heritage during a unique day

This Sunday, April 19th, Beaune will be the venue for the "World Heritage in Celebration" event. For the first time, the nine UNESCO World Heritage sites in Burgundy-Franche-Comté are joining forces to offer a common day, both festive and educational, in the heart of their territories.

 

HAS Beaune The spotlight will be on the famous Climats of the Burgundy vineyards. Designated a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 2015, they embody a cultural landscape shaped by centuries of winemaking expertise. The event will take place at... Domaine Baptiste Guyot , at the foot of the premier crus of the Montagne de Beaune From 10:30 am to 5:30 pm, the site will welcome young and old for an immersion in the world of Climats.

On the agenda: a fun 1 hour 15 minute walk through the vineyard. Equipped with a puzzle booklet, visitors will set off to discover ten information panels covering landscapes, biodiversity, geology, and appellations. At each stop, a puzzle or game will add a fun element to the walk. A wine tasting, offered by the winemakers of the... appellation Beaune will conclude this walk. Accessible independently, it will also be offered as a guided tour at 11am.

Entertainment for the whole family

Beyond the walk, numerous activities will punctuate the day. Participatory games, themed workshops, and fun activities will allow visitors to learn more about world heritage while having fun.

Highlights included:

  • A "Journey to UNESCO World Heritage Sites" to connect iconic objects and sites,
  • A Mölkky game reimagined around heritage.
  • An interactive wheel to test your knowledge.
  • Workshops focusing on biodiversity and landscape.

Families won't be left out, with a travel journal specially designed for children, inviting them to explore the region's nine UNESCO World Heritage sites through a stamp-collecting route. A competition will also be held throughout the day, with prizes of significant heritage value up for grabs.

With "World Heritage in Celebration", Bourgogne-Franche-Comté intends to promote the richness and diversity of its UNESCO-listed sites, while raising public awareness of their preservation.
